> Problem:
> Today the user needs to make sure that crucial UpdateProcessors like the Log- 
> and Run UpdateProcessors are present when creating a new 
> UpdateRequestProcessorChain. This is error prone, and when introducing a new 
> core UpdateProcessor, like in SOLR-2358, all existing users need to insert 
> the changes into all their pipelines.
> A customer made pipeline should not need to care about distributed indexing, 
> logging or anything else, and should be as slim as possible.
> Proposal:
> The proposal is to lend from the <first-components> and <last-components> 
> pattern used in RequestHandler configs. In that way, we could let all core 
> processors be included either first or last by default in all UpdateChains.
> To do this, we need a place to configure the defaults, e.g. by a 
> default="true" param:
> {code:xml}
> <updateRequestProcessorChain name="default" default="true">
>   <first-processors>
>     <processor class="solr.DistributedUpdateRequestProcessor"/>
>   </first-processors>
>   <last-processors>
>     <processor class="solr.LogUpdateProcessorFactory" />
>     <processor class="solr.RunUpdateProcessorFactory" />
>   </last-processors>
> </updateRequestProcessorChain>
> {code}
> Next, the customer made chain will be only the "center" part:
> {code:xml}
> <updateRequestProcessorChain name="mychain">
>   <processor class="my.nice.DoSomethingProcessor"/>
>   <processor class="my.nice.DoAnotherThingProcessor"/>
> </updateRequestProcessorChain>
> {code}
> To override the core processors config for a particular chain, you would 
> start a clean chain by parameter reset="true"
> {code:xml}
> <updateRequestProcessorChain name="mychain" reset="true">
>   <processor class="my.nice.DoSomethingProcessor"/>
>   <processor class="my.nice.DoAnotherThingProcessor"/>
>   <processor class="solr.RunUpdateProcessorFactory" />
> </updateRequestProcessorChain>
> {code}
> If you only need to make sure that one of your custom processors run at the 
> very beginning or the very end, you could use:
> {code:xml}
> <updateRequestProcessorChain name="mychain">
>   <processor class="my.nice.DoSomethingProcessor"/>
>   <processor class="my.nice.DoAnotherThingProcessor"/>
>   <last-processors>
>     <processor class="solr.MySpecialDebugProcessor" />
>   </last-processors>
> </updateRequestProcessorChain>
> {code}
> The default should be reset="false", but the example schema could keep the 
> default chain commented out to provide backward compatibility for upgraders.
